The Khabarovsk Carousel offers a raw glimpse into the tumultuous protests of 2020 in Russia's Khabarovsk Territory. The film captures the frenetic energy of ordinary citizens rallying for their arrested governor, Sergei Furgal. It’s not just a political documentary; it’s about community, identity, and a fight for voice. The pacing is quite dynamic, oscillating between moments of charged tension and quieter reflections. The cinematography feels immediate, almost intrusive at times, which really draws you into the atmosphere of unrest. You can sense the palpable hope and desperation in the crowd's chants. It’s distinctive, not just for its subject matter but for how it intimately portrays the human spirit in the face of authority.
